Abstract(in English) In case of organic thin films with a strong optical absorption, transmission spectra are influenced by an increase of reflected light, and it is difficult to measure the optical absorption correctly. Therefore, the optical absorption spectra measured by attenuated total reflection (ATR) method of reflection measurements were compared with the transmission spectra. The ATR spectra of a copper phthalocyanine (CuPc) thin film with difference thicknesses were measured for an incident light of p- and s-polarizations. The ATR spectra depending on the conditions of the polarized light and the film thickness were obtained from the ATR measurements. In the p-polarized ATR spectra of the 25-nm CuPc films, particularly, a new attenuated peak was observed at the high energy side of the CuPc absorption spectra. The new peaks are attributed to low refractive index influenced on the strong absorption bands of the CuPc.
